Abstract

The table saw comprises a base, a working table plate with a cutting slot, a cooling liquid containing basin, a saw blade partially extending out of the cutting slot and a shield assembly, wherein the shield assembly comprises a shield used for covering the saw blade, the shield can move upwards under the action of a workpiece, at least one part of the shield is attached to the workpiece in a working state, the workpiece can slide relative to the shield, and the shield comprises a guide wall, and in the working state, the guide wall is tightly attached to the workpiece and guides the cooling liquid to the cutting slot on the workpiece, which is cut by the saw blade. The table saw has the functions of guiding and collecting the cooling liquid brought out by the saw blade and guiding the cooling liquid back into the cooling liquid containing basin through the cutting seam of the working table plate, effectively controls the cooling liquid splashed in the cutting process of the workpiece, avoids the splashing of the cooling liquid to pollute an operator, the working table plate and the workpiece, saves the time for cleaning the workpiece after cutting, and improves the operation comfort level of the operator.

Description

Bench saw
Technical field
The present invention relates to bench saw, relate in particular to the cooling fluid flow guide system of bench saw.
Background technology
Bench saw can be for the material such as cutting tile, earthenware brick.As shown in Figure 1, existing bench saw mainly comprises base 11, be supported in working plate 12 on base 11, be positioned at the saw blade 14 that the cooling fluid of working plate 12 belows is held basin 13, driven by motor, and is installed on the cover assembly 15 on base 11.
In operating process, saw blade 14 is driven by motor and makes high speed rotary motion, and workpiece is placed on working plate 12, and operator pushes workpiece to saw blade 14 at leisure, thereby realizes cutting.Saw blade 14 is in the time of High Rotation Speed, and the cooling fluid that cooling fluid can be held in basin 13 is taken the cutting zone on working plate 12 to, to reach cooling object.But meanwhile, the cutting edge of saw blade 14 and periphery have a large amount of cooling fluids to splash.Existing bench saw adopts cover assembly 15 to stop the cooling fluid of splashing, but cover assembly 15 can only hide the saw blade 14 of part, still have outside part saw blade is exposed to, therefore cover assembly 15 can only stop a part of cooling fluid of being taken out of by saw blade, still there is a large amount of cooling fluids to splash out, splash with it operator, flow on working plate and workpiece, as shown in the arrow in Fig. 1.Therefore, in the time of cut workpiece, the cooling fluid that operator can be taken up by the saw blade clothes of making dirty, in addition, the water being stopped by cover assembly can drop onto on working plate or workpiece, make dirty working plate and workpiece.
Summary of the invention
The object of the invention is to overcome the deficiencies in the prior art, provide a kind of and can in cutting process, effectively prevent the bench saw that cooling fluid is splashed.
Bench saw of the present invention comprises base, be supported on base, for the working plate of place work piece, on working plate, have joint-cutting, be positioned at working plate below, hold basin for the cooling fluid of holding cooling fluid, driven the saw blade of rotation by motor, saw blade partly stretches out from the joint-cutting of working plate, be installed near the cover assembly on working plate or working plate, cover assembly comprises the guard shield for hiding saw blade, guard shield can move upward under the effect of workpiece, in working order, at least a portion of guard shield and workpiece laminating, and workpiece can slide with respect to guard shield, guard shield comprises guiding wall, in working order, guiding wall is close on workpiece, and by the cooling fluid incision of having been cut by saw blade on workpiece that leads.
In working order, at least a portion of bench saw guard shield of the present invention and workpiece laminating, between guard shield and workpiece, form a cavity, the cooling fluid of taking on working plate during by saw blade High Rotation Speed is controlled in cavity, and can not splash to outside guard shield, therefore effectively control the cooling fluid of splashing.Be dropped in cooling fluid on workpiece under the effect of guiding wall, be directed to the incision of having been cut by saw blade on workpiece, make cooling fluid to leave surface of the work from workpiece incision, ensured that surface of the work does not have unnecessary cooling fluid.
Preferably, workpiece otch aligns substantially with working plate joint-cutting, and therefore cooling fluid can be passed through workpiece otch and working plate joint-cutting, gets back to cooling fluid and holds in basin.Therefore, bench saw of the present invention has the cooling fluid guiding of being taken out of by saw blade, collect, lead back cooling fluid through working plate joint-cutting holds the function in basin, effectively control the cooling fluid spilling in work piece cut process, operator, working plate and workpiece are avoided cooling fluid to splash out making dirty, save the time of clean workpiece after cutting, improved operator's operational comfort.

Detailed description of the invention
As shown in Figures 2 and 3, bench saw of the present invention comprises base 21, be supported on base 21 and for the working plate 22 of place work piece 20, be positioned at the saw blade 24 that the cooling fluid of working plate 22 belows is held basin 23 (Fig. 7 has demonstration), driven by motor (not shown), and cover assembly 25.On near the parts that cover assembly 25 can be arranged on working plate 22 or working plate 22 is, it comprises the guard shield 254 for hiding saw blade 24.On working plate 22, have joint-cutting 220 (having demonstration in Fig. 6), saw blade 24 partly stretches out from joint-cutting 220.Under the off working state shown in Fig. 2, the extension of saw blade 24 is covered by guard shield 254.
Bench saw of the present invention also comprises cooling fluid flow guide system, this cooling fluid flow guide system can be taken saw blade 24 when the High Rotation Speed out of cooling fluid and hold the cooling fluid of basin 23 and be controlled at guard shield 254 inside, and by being connected in the deflector of guard shield 254, direct coolant is left guard shield 254, through the joint-cutting 220 of working plate, flow back to cooling fluid and hold in basin 23, thereby realize collection, the backflow of cooling fluid.Cooling fluid flow guide system comprise control the cooling fluid of being taken out of by saw blade cover assembly 25, there is the working plate 22 of joint-cutting 220, and the cooling fluid of holding cooling fluid is held basin 23.
Describe in detail below realize to the cooling fluid of being taken out of by saw blade control, the structure of the cover assembly 25 of water conservancy diversion.
It should be noted that, the present invention's said " front end " refers in the time of operation, near one end of operator; " rear end " refers to the one end away from operator.
As shown in Figure 4, cover assembly 25 comprises with knife plate 251, linkage 252, locking knob 253, guard shield 254, and is arranged on the flexible rings 255 on guard shield lower surface.Cover assembly 25 by be installed on working plate 22 with knife plate 251 or working plate 22 near parts on, specifically, lower end with knife plate 251 has installing hole 2511, bolt (not shown) is through installing hole 2511, again with working plate 22 or working plate 22 near other parts on screwed hole (not shown) coordinate, thereby will be fixed on working plate 22 or near working plate 22 with knife plate 251 and whole cover assembly 25.
The guard shield 254 of cover assembly 25 is connected with following knife plate 251 by linkage 252, and therefore, guard shield 254 can be with respect to moving up and down with knife plate 251.Linkage 252 comprises connecting rod 2521, lower link 2522, and is connected in the extension spring 2523 between upper and lower strut 2521,2522.On guard shield 254, extend the first installing plate 2541 and the second installing plate 2542 that are parallel to each other, between first, second installing plate 2541,2542, have interval.The first end of upper and lower connecting rod 2521,2522 is installed on the upper end with knife plate 251 by bolt 2524 respectively, the second end inserts the interval between first, second installing plate 2541,2542, and is connected on first, second installing plate 2541,2542 by bolt 2525.Extension spring 2523 provides an active force, and guard shield 254 is fitted tightly with working plate 22 or workpiece 20 all the time.In the off working state shown in Fig. 2, guard shield 254 fits tightly with working plate 22, and flexible rings 255 is installed on the lower surface due to guard shield 254, therefore between guard shield 254 and working plate 22, forms the chamber of a sealing; Duty as shown in Figure 7, guard shield 254 fits tightly with workpiece 20 at least in part, and workpiece 20 can move with respect to guard shield 254.In other embodiments, extension spring 2523 also can substitute with other flexible members such as torsion springs, even can be omitted, and in the situation that being omitted, guard shield 254 relies on gravity and working plate 22 or workpiece 20 to fit.
Locking knob 253 is connected with one of them bolt 2524, for guard shield 254 is fixed on to arbitrary height.In the present embodiment, locking knob 253 is connected with the bolt 2524 of upper connecting rod 2521 first ends, and in the time that locking knob 253 is screwed, upper connecting rod 2521 is fixed, and guard shield 254 is fixed on a certain height; In the time that locking knob 253 unclamps, under the effect of external force, guard shield 254 can move up and down.In other embodiments, locking knob 253 also can be connected with the bolt 2524 of lower link 2522 first ends.
As shown in Figure 4, the front end of guard shield 254 has window 2540, and operator can observe cut point easily by window 2540.The cut point here refers to the point that the cutting edge of saw blade contacts with workpiece.Window 2540 has dividing plate 2570, and by dividing plate 2570 in two.The width of dividing plate 2570 is slightly larger than the thickness of saw blade 24, and is positioned at the top of saw blade 24 cut points, for the smear metal that stops that working angles produces, prevents that smear metal from flying into operator's eyes.The shape or the quantity that are appreciated that window can change as required, as long as can observe easily cut point.
The front end of guard shield 254 is also provided with a pair of guiding rib 2543 extending obliquely upward.As shown in Figure 3, in the time cutting work, workpiece 20 is placed on working plate 22, operator pushes workpiece 20 to saw blade 24, and workpiece 20 first touches guiding rib 2543, then overcomes the active force of extension spring 2523, guard shield 254 is lifted, so guard shield 254 drops on workpiece 20, under the effect of extension spring 2523, fit tightly with workpiece 20.As shown in Figure 7, in the time that workpiece 20 not yet moves to guard shield 254 rear end, the bottom surface section ground of guard shield 254 fits tightly with workpiece 20; As shown in Figure 8, in the time that workpiece 20 moves to guard shield 254 rear end, the lower surface of guard shield 254 fully fits tightly with workpiece 20.
As shown in Figure 9, the rear end of flexible rings 255 is provided with the guiding wall 2553 flowing to for direct coolant, and this guiding wall 2553 is embodied in V-type inclined-plane.Under the effect of extension spring 2523, guiding wall 2553 is close on workpiece 20.Preferably, flexible rings 255 is rubber ring; In other embodiments, flexible rings 255 can also adopt felt, hairbrush etc. other have flexible material.
As shown in Figure 5, guard shield 254 is roughly arch on the whole.As shown in Figure 6, the cross section of guard shield 254 is also arch, and it has the inwall of arch, this inwall from the guard shield central area that is positioned at saw blade top towards both sides outwards and to downward-extension.Guard shield 254 comprises relative the first side wall 2544 and the second sidewall 2545.Therefore, the moulding of guard shield 254 makes a chamber of its inner formation.In Fig. 5, the first side wall 2544 is removed, and therefore can clearly illustrate the internal structure of guard shield 254.The first deflector 2546 and the second deflector 2547 are installed respectively in the bottom of the inwall of first, second sidewall 2544,2545, first, second deflector 2546,2547 is respectively along the inwall of first, second sidewall 2544,2545, be tilted to downward-extension towards the rear end of guard shield 254, be the front end of first, second deflector 2546,2547 higher than rear end, the angle β between first, second deflector 2546,2547 and horizontal plane is greater than 1 °.Between first, second deflector 2546,2547, there is interval, pass through for saw blade 24.In the cutaway view shown in Fig. 6, first, second deflector 2546,2547 is a "eight" shape.Arranging of first, second deflector 2546,2547 formed first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549.On the first flow-guiding channel 2548, the part 2556 of close saw blade 24 is higher than the part 2566 being connected with guard shield 254 inwalls; On the second flow-guiding channel 2549, the part 2557 of close saw blade 24 is higher than the part 2567 being connected with guard shield 254 inwalls.
In the rear end of guard shield 254, between first, second deflector 2546,2547, form a delivery port 2560, in workpiece direction of feed, delivery port 2560 aligns substantially with saw blade 24.Delivery port 2560 communicates with working plate joint-cutting 220, and in the time that workpiece 20 moves to guard shield 254 rear ends, delivery port 2560 below, delivery port 2560 communicates with the workpiece otch 200 having been cut by saw blade 24 on workpiece 20 and joint-cutting 220.Preferably, in the vertical direction,, in the direction perpendicular to working plate 22, delivery port 2560 aligns substantially with working plate joint-cutting 220, when after workpiece 20 moves to saw blade 24, when delivery port 2560 below, delivery port 2560 aligns substantially with workpiece otch 200 and joint-cutting 220.Those skilled in the art can expect easily, and delivery port 2560 can partly align with workpiece otch 200 and joint-cutting 220, or utilizes additional guide to be interconnected.
Before delivery port 2560, set up baffle plate 2550, because first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549 narrows gradually in rear end, the object that therefore increases baffle plate 2550 is to prevent that in first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549, cooling fluid is back on workpiece 20.
Be provided with in guard shield 254 inside and be roughly inverted the first U-shaped water fender 2551 and the second water fender 2552, bring the cooling fluid in guard shield 254 into for stopping by saw blade 24, and the cooling fluid splashing on first, second water fender 2551,2552 is guided in first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549.First, second water fender 2551,2552 is connected between the top and first, second deflector 2546,2547 in guard shield 254, and and the inner surface of first, second sidewall 2544,2545 of guard shield 254 between leave gap.In other embodiments, first, second water fender 2551,2552 also can only be connected on the inner surface of first, second sidewall 2544,2545, or is only connected with first, second deflector 2546,2547.
As shown in Figure 7, cooling fluid is held in basin 23 cooling fluid is housed, and a part for saw blade 24 immerses in cooling fluid.Saw blade 24 rear sides are provided with the 3rd water fender 231, the lower end of the 3rd water fender 231 is also immersed in cooling fluid, and a flexible body extending towards saw blade 24 232 is laterally installed in upper end, and flexible body 232 is cut a seam, saw blade 24, through this seam, directly contacts with flexible body 232.Preferably, flexible body 232 is felt; In other embodiments, flexible body 232 also can adopt other flexible materials to make.
The course of work of cooling fluid flow guide system is described below.
In working order, saw blade 24 is driven and is made High Rotation Speed by motor, and a large amount of cooling fluids is driven thereupon and rotated together, and as shown in the dotted arrow in Fig. 7, this dotted arrow represents to be taken out of by saw blade 24 the cooling fluid injection direction that cooling fluid is held basin 23.Wherein a part of cooling fluid can be stopped by flexible body 232, holds in basin 23 thereby drop onto cooling fluid; Some cooling fluid can spray the gap between flexible body 232 and saw blade 24, is taken on working plate 22, for cooling saw blade 24 by saw blade 24.Because flexible body 232 directly contacts with the cutting edge of saw blade 24, therefore cooling fluid will be distributed on the cutting edge of saw blade 24, thereby has reduced the cooling fluid being brought on working plate 22.
As shown in the dotted arrow in Fig. 5-7, the cooling fluid arriving on working plate 22 can enter in guard shield 254 along the tangential direction of saw blade 24, splashes on the inner surface and first, second water fender 2551,2552 of guard shield 254.As shown in the solid arrow in Fig. 5-7, this solid arrow represents the flow direction of the cooling fluid that is blocked, collects.Splash cooling fluid on guard shield 254 inwalls along inwall, i.e. the inner surface of first, second sidewall 2544,2545, flows in first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549; Meanwhile, splash the cooling fluid on first, second water fender 2551,2552, stopped by first, second water fender 2551,2552, then can flow in first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549 along first, second water fender 2551,2552.Be collected into the cooling fluid in first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549, flow to the afterbody of guard shield 254 along the incline direction of first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549, be pooled to delivery port 2560 places, due to delivery port, 2560 places are provided with baffle plate 2550, and therefore the cooling fluid at delivery port 2560 places can not be back in guard shield 254.As shown in Figure 7, in the time that workpiece 20 not yet moves to guard shield 254 rear ends, delivery port 2560 below, delivery port 2560 aligns substantially with working plate joint-cutting 220, therefore, be collected in cooling fluid in first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549 from delivery port 2560 out, through working plate joint-cutting 220, splash into cooling fluid and hold in basin 23.As shown in Figure 8, in the time that workpiece 20 moves to guard shield 254 rear ends, delivery port 2560 below, delivery port 2560 and workpiece otch 200, and joint-cutting 220 aligns substantially, therefore, the cooling fluid being collected in first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549 flows out from delivery port 2560, through workpiece otch 200, working plate joint-cutting 220, finally splashes into cooling fluid and holds in basin 23.
Although most of cooling fluid of being brought in guard shield 254 by saw blade 24 can be collected in first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549, also have part cooling fluid not to be collected in first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549, but drop on workpiece 20.As shown in Figure 9, be not collected into first, the second flow-guiding channel 2548, cooling fluid in 2549 is enclosed in the workpiece area that guard shield 254 covered by flexible rings 255, as shown in the solid arrow in figure, in the time of cutting, along with workpiece 20 is little by little pushed to the rear end of guard shield 254, be positioned at cooling fluid in the workpiece area that guard shield 254 covers also moves to guard shield 254 gradually rear end along with workpiece 20, this part cooling fluid is guided to workpiece otch 200 places by the guiding wall 2553 of flexible rings, through workpiece otch 200, working plate joint-cutting 220, the final cooling fluid that flows into is held in basin 23.
By above-mentioned cooling fluid flow guide system, the cooling fluid of being taken out of by saw blade 24 is controlled at guard shield 254 inside effectively, then effectively being collected and lead back cooling fluid holds in basin 23, effectively avoid cooling fluid to splash out, make dirty operator and workpiece, improved the comfort level of operator's cut workpiece.
In other embodiments, first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549 also can be arranged on the outside of guard shield 254, extends to the rear end of guard shield along the outer wall of guard shield 254, forms the mouth of a river 2560.Be collected in cooling fluid in first, second flow-guiding channel 2548,2549 from delivery port 2560 out, through the joint-cutting 220 on working plate, final inflow held basin 23.
As shown in figure 10, as another embodiment of the invention, this embodiment and the difference of above-mentioned preferred embodiment are, following on knife plate 251 ' of cover assembly 25 ' has two grooves 2511 ', for cooling fluid is guided to incision, preferably, groove 2511 ' is arc.Those skilled in the art can expect easily, can be not limited to two with the groove 2511 ' on knife plate 251 ', and the groove of other quantity also can be realized same object.Specifically, the shape of groove 2511 ' is identical with the movement locus of delivery port, thereby has ensured in whole cutting process, and delivery port keeps communicating with groove 2511 '.Therefore, guard shield 254 ' is on differing heights, and the cooling fluid of collecting in first, second flow-guiding channel can be passed through delivery port, be entered groove 2511 ', then passes through workpiece otch and working plate joint-cutting, finally flows into cooling fluid and holds basin.This embodiment can more effectively be controlled the cooling fluid of collecting in flow-guiding channel and lead back and hold basin.
